Job Details

We are seeking a Trust and Estate Paralegal with a minimum of 3 years of experience in estate administration, estate planning and probate. The ideal candidate will have a proven track record of managing estate files from inception through distribution, a strong understanding of tax preparation related to estates, and the ability to provide exceptional service to our clients. Experience with high net-worth clients is highly desirable.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Assist attorneys with the administration of estates and trusts, including probate court filings, estate tax returns, and accountings.
  • Directly communicate with clients, beneficiaries, and other professionals to gather and provide information, fostering strong relationships.
  • Prepare and file various probate and administration documents, inventories, accountings, and tax returns with minimal supervision.
  • Manage estate and trust bank accounts, including the preparation of checks, account statements, and fiduciary accountings.
  • Coordinate the valuation of assets and maintain detailed records of estate assets and distributions.
  • Assist in the preparation and filing of federal and state estate tax returns; experience with income tax preparation is a significant plus.
  • Support attorneys in estate planning, including drafting wills, trusts, and other estate planning documents.
